## 문제

A 4-year-old child diagnosed with Kawasaki disease is in the acute phase and has developed coronary artery aneurysms. The child's temperature is 102.8°F (39.3°C), heart rate is 140 bpm, and the child appears irritable. What is the nurse's priority action?

## 보기

1. Administer acetaminophen for fever reduction
2. Apply cool compresses to reduce inflammation
3. Encourage increased fluid intake to prevent dehydration
4. Monitor for signs of myocardial infarction and arrhythmias **✔ 정답**

**정답: 4**

## 해설

Children with Kawasaki disease and coronary artery aneurysms are at high risk for myocardial infarction and arrhythmias, making cardiac monitoring the priority. Other actions (fever reduction, hydration) are supportive but secondary to preventing life-threatening cardiac events.

Understanding the Priority in Acute Kawasaki Disease with Coronary Artery Aneurysms

The child is in the acute phase of Kawasaki disease (KD) and has already developed coronary artery aneurysms, a serious complication. While fever and irritability are concerning symptoms, the nurse's priority action must focus on the most life-threatening risk. The presence of coronary artery aneurysms fundamentally changes the clinical picture, as these weakened vessel walls are prone to thrombosis and can lead to myocardial ischemia. Therefore, vigilant monitoring for signs of myocardial infarction and arrhythmias is the top priority.

Why Monitoring for Myocardial Infarction and Arrhythmias is the Priority

Kawasaki disease is a systemic vasculitis that is the leading cause of acquired heart disease in children. The acute inflammatory process can damage the coronary arteries, leading to dilation or aneurysm formation. The provided literature underscores the critical nature of this complication. One source notes that cardiovascular complications "can cause significant morbidity and mortality" [1]. The most immediate and lethal threats from coronary artery aneurysms are thrombotic occlusion, causing myocardial infarction, and the electrical instability that triggers malignant arrhythmias. A case report on adult KD sequelae explicitly states that when acute myocardial infarction occurs in this population, outcomes are poor due to "life-threatening complications, including malignant ventricular arrhythmias and cardiogenic shock" [3]. This pathophysiological link makes continuous cardiac and hemodynamic monitoring the essential nursing action to detect early signs of deterioration, such as chest pain (difficult to assess in an irritable 4-year-old), changes in heart rhythm, or hypotension.

Analysis of Other Options

- Option 1 (Administer acetaminophen): While fever management is a component of care, it is not the priority. The fever is a symptom of the underlying vasculitis. Standard treatment for KD involves high-dose acetylsalicylic acid (ASA) for its anti-inflammatory effects, and sometimes corticosteroids, not acetaminophen as a first-line KD-specific therapy [1]. Administering a simple antipyretic does not address the life-threatening risk of coronary thrombosis.

- Option 2 (Apply cool compresses): This intervention is aimed at comfort and local inflammation reduction. It has no impact on the systemic vasculitis or the critical risk of myocardial ischemia stemming from coronary aneurysms. It is a supportive measure, not a priority action.

- Option 3 (Encourage increased fluid intake): Preventing dehydration is important for any febrile child. However, in the context of existing coronary artery aneurysms, the risk of sudden cardiac death from an ischemic event far outweighs the risk of dehydration. This is a secondary nursing consideration that can be addressed after ensuring the child is hemodynamically stable and on a cardiac monitor.

Connecting Pathophysiology to Clinical Judgment

The clinical reasoning here is rooted in the "ABC" (Airway, Breathing, Circulation) priority framework, where "Circulation" is the immediate threat. The coronary artery aneurysms represent a direct and unstable compromise to myocardial circulation. A scientific statement on coronary testing in pediatric patients highlights the importance of detecting inducible ischemia in conditions like KD with coronary aneurysms . The nurse at the bedside is the first line of defense in recognizing the clinical manifestations of this ischemia. A change in the child's irritability could be an anginal equivalent, and a subtle change in heart rate or rhythm on the monitor could be the first sign of a developing arrhythmia. The priority is not to treat a single symptom like fever, but to surveil for the catastrophic consequence of the existing pathology: myocardial infarction.References (research sources)

Clinical Priority: Acute Kawasaki Disease with Coronary Aneurysms

**Scenario:** A 4-year-old child in the acute phase of Kawasaki disease has developed coronary artery aneurysms. The child remains febrile and irritable.

Priority Nursing Action

The immediate priority is continuous cardiac monitoring to detect life-threatening complications. The presence of coronary artery aneurysms elevates the risk of thrombotic occlusion, myocardial infarction, and malignant arrhythmias above all other concerns.

- **Monitor for Myocardial Ischemia/Infarction:** Assess for chest pain (which may present as irritability or inconsolable crying in a 4-year-old), pallor, diaphoresis, and unexplained tachycardia. Obtain a 12-lead ECG and cardiac enzymes immediately if suspected.

- **Monitor for Arrhythmias:** Continuous telemetry is required. Watch for ventricular tachycardia or fibrillation, which are common terminal events in thrombotic occlusion of an aneurysm.

- **Frequent Vital Signs:** Monitor heart rate and blood pressure every 1-2 hours. Hypotension and new-onset gallop rhythm (S3/S4) may indicate myocardial pump failure.

Clinical Reasoning

While fever management and hydration are components of supportive care, they do not address the most immediate threat to life. Coronary artery aneurysms have weakened walls with turbulent blood flow, predisposing them to thrombosis. This can rapidly progress to a fatal myocardial infarction. The nurse's priority is to detect early signs of this progression to facilitate emergency intervention, such as thrombolysis or percutaneous coronary intervention.

## 핵심 개념

- **Kawasaki disease** — An acute systemic vasculitis primarily affecting children under 5, which can lead to coronary artery aneurysms and is the leading cause of acquired heart disease in children.
- **Coronary artery aneurysm** — A pathological dilation of a coronary artery segment, a serious complication of Kawasaki disease that increases the risk of thrombosis, myocardial infarction, and sudden death.
- **Myocardial infarction** — Necrosis of heart muscle caused by an obstruction of blood supply, often due to thrombosis within a pre-existing coronary artery aneurysm in the context of Kawasaki disease.
- **Priority setting** — A clinical decision-making framework, often using Maslow's hierarchy or the ABCs, to determine the most life-threatening risk requiring immediate intervention.
- **Acute phase** — The initial stage of Kawasaki disease (days 1-14) characterized by high fever, irritability, and systemic inflammation, during which vasculitis and aneurysm formation begin.
